Nawadih Population - Ranchi, Jharkhand

Nawadih is a medium size village located in Rahe Block of Ranchi district, Jharkhand with total 143 families residing. The Nawadih village has population of 638 of which 336 are males while 302 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Nawadih village population of children with age 0-6 is 102 which makes up 15.99 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Nawadih village is 899 which is lower than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Nawadih as per census is 1125, higher than Jharkhand average of 948.

Nawadih village has lower liter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Nawadih village was 54.29 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Nawadih Male literacy stands at 67.71 % while female literacy rate was 38.71 %.

Caste Factor

Nawadih village of Ranchi has substantial population of Schedule Caste.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 30.88 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 9.87 % of total population in Nawadih village.

Work Profile

In Nawadih village out of total population, 323 were engaged in work activities. 52.63 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 47.37 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 323 workers engaged in Main Work, 47 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 111 were Agricultural labourer.
